Netflix

Product Manager, Enterprise Systems

New York, New York, United States of America

Found: January 17, 2026

This role is based in New York, New York, United States of America.

Compensation:

$300K - $600K/year

About the Role:

Seeking a Product Manager to build a data and integration platform that connects enterprise systems, centralizes data, and automates workflows.

Responsibilities:

  • Define and execute product vision and roadmap for data integration.
  • Oversee data centralization and integration using APIs.
  • Conduct buy vs. build analysis for third-party tools.
  • Gather requirements from stakeholders and translate them into product features.
  • Ensure data quality and compliance across integrated systems.
  • Partner with analytics teams for actionable insights.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's Degree.
  • 4+ years of product management experience.
  • Strong understanding of data platforms and APIs.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• Ability to operate strategically and dive into technical details.
